The Best Value Forestry Master's Degree Schools in Texas 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ision.

Our ranking of value is based on the quality of a program as defined in our per sticker price dollar.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.

In our regional and nationwide rankings, out-of-state tution and fees are used in our calculations.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.

Best Forestry Master's Degree School

Our analysis found Stephen F Austin State University to be the best value school for forestry students who want to pursue a master’s degree in Texas. SFASU is a fairly large public school located in the remote town of Nacogdoches.

In-state tuition fees for graduate students at SFASU are $7,433 per year.
